HVIIR rights saw no change in price during the latest session, closing at $0.37 with a net change of 0.00%. The rights have been trading in a narrow range of approximately $0.35 to $0.39 over recent sessions, indicating a lack of strong directional bias. Volume levels remain subdued, likely reflecting the limited float and specialized nature of rights trading. These securities represent the right to purchase shares of Hennessy Capital Investment Corp. VII upon a business combination, and their price action is closely tied to expectations of a successful merger. The current period of low volatility may persist as market participants await substantive news regarding the sponsor’s target acquisition. Sector positioning is heavily dependent on SPAC dynamics, and the rights market often exhibits limited liquidity compared to common shares. The 0.00% change aligns with the rights’ typical pattern of low volatility when no major corporate events are pending.

Looking ahead, HVIIR rights could remain range-bound until a definitive event triggers a move. A break above resistance at $0.39 might signal renewed optimism regarding the SPAC’s business combination, potentially lifting prices toward the next psychological level near $0.42. Conversely, a fall below support at $0.35 could open the door to further downside, possibly toward $0.32, if sentiment turns negative. Factors that may influence future performance include updates on the target company’s financial health, regulatory approvals, or any extension votes that could affect the SPAC’s timeline. Should the rights approach their expiration date without a deal, the securities may lose value. Conversely, a high-quality target announcement could generate a surge in demand. Investors should monitor news flow closely for any filings or press releases from Hennessy Capital Investment Corp. VII. As with any rights issue, the securities may be subject to greater price swings on low volume. Current conditions suggest limited near-term catalysts, so a break from the $0.35–$0.39 range may require a significant development.
